Subject: Handover — Coinlatch payments release

Taking over from this cycle: the Coinlatch integration suite is flaky on the settlement-webhook tests; rerun twice before declaring red. Plugin authors should pin against the 4.2 contract until the fix lands. Release artifacts still require signature verification on upload. Sign plugin submissions with the current release key below.

release key, kahif-yagap: bky3_1JN

### Sandboxing User Formulas (plugin authors)

All formulas submitted through the Copperquill plugin API execute inside the Hollowcell sandbox. Your plugin must not assume filesystem, network, or timer access; calls to those surfaces return a capability error. Declare needed functions in your manifest and the sandbox whitelists them at load. Violations terminate the formula and log an incident record keyed to the token below.

build token for kahop-kagag: htk31_38a3512afc721db8009f808ec553b14

A note for incoming contractors: bulk edits in the Harrowfield admin table are handled by Gridloom, a licensed component from Veldacre Software. Please do not modify its row-selection or batch-commit logic directly, as changes can void our support agreement. All customizations must go through the vendor's configuration layer. If you need a feature added or a defect reported, write to their support team here.

pager mailbox: eliix.frador@lumicworks.corp

TURN-208: Gatevale turnstile counters at the Merrow Field pilot double-count when a rotation reverses mid-cycle. Attendance totals drift roughly 2% high per event. The debounce window fix is implemented, reviewed by Ilsa, and soak-tested across two simulated match days without drift. Ready for your cut; the candidate build is identified below.

trace token, tagag-tafog: htk6_5ed18c

## Hot-reload procedure — Kestrelbox

Kestrelbox watches its config directory and reloads within five seconds of a write, without restarting workers. Support should verify the reload log line before declaring a change applied; partial writes are rejected atomically. The reloadable configuration values currently in effect are the following.

deployment values, bahap-bahip:
[eliath]
team = gorius
access_code = ac_9ce55b
owner = holion.eliius
host = eliath.nelvrohq.internal
port = 8443
peer = kaswyn.merlaqlabs.test
salt = 01afd960
pin = 5193